Binance Trade Jury
Use this skill to review a Binance trade thesis before it becomes a real position.
Public endpoints:
- Review API:
https://binance-trade-jury.vercel.app/api/trade-jury - Share image:
https://binance-trade-jury.vercel.app/api/trade-jury/share-image
When to use it
- The user wants a second opinion on a Binance trade idea.
- The user asks whether a long or short thesis is worth taking.
- The user wants a verdict backed by Binance market data instead of generic chat.
- The user wants a clearer entry, invalidation, and no-chase plan.
- The user wants a verdict card or social post for a reviewed thesis.
Workflow
- Extract the trade symbol. Accept either
BTCorBTCUSDT. - Extract the side as
LONGorSHORT. If the user does not specify, default toLONG. - Extract the full thesis text. If the user gives no thesis, ask for it.
- Optionally extract bankroll in USD. If none is given, send
null. - Run:
curl -sS -X POST https://binance-trade-jury.vercel.app/api/trade-jury \
-H 'Content-Type: application/json' \
-d '{"symbol":"\x3Csymbol>","side":"\x3CLONG|SHORT>","thesis":"\x3Cthesis>","bankrollUsd":null}'
-
Base the answer on the returned JSON. The most important fields are:
verdictscoreheadlinesummaryjurorsconcernsapprovalConditionsplaybookshareText
-
If the user wants a share card, build a payload with:
verdictscoresymbolsideheadlinesummaryprimaryJurorprimaryConcerngeneratedAt
Then URL-encode the JSON and append it to:
https://binance-trade-jury.vercel.app/api/trade-jury/share-image?payload=\x3Curlencoded-json>
Output guidance
- Lead with the verdict and why the bench reached it.
- Quote the three jurors in short form when useful.
- Keep the playbook concrete: starter, add, invalidation, no-chase, and risk cap.
- Do not invent exchange-private data or portfolio permissions. This skill uses Binance public market data only.
- If the API fails, surface the error and suggest retrying with a cleaner symbol or tighter thesis.
